Music
Music in the Prep School remained virtual until
mid-January. Fortnightly Zoom lessons alternated
with Firefly assignments in which students were en-
couraged to practise their practical skills at home and
celebrate their achievements by sending in video re-
cordings, which were than shared during our virtual
lessons.
Videos received featured home-made ‘kitchen drum-
kits’ and stylish imitations of the great conductors.
The ‘Winter Concert’ was simulated virtually with the
help of a number of amazing Karaoke performances.
Since the return of live lessons, pupils have made the
most of the opportunity to make live music together.
Weekly Music lessons have focused a great deal on
the joys of class singing, beginning with ‘Love is All
You Need’ for St Valentine’s Day and culminating in
performances of some of the greatest hit songs from
the last seventy years as part of our Queen Elizabeth
Jubilee celebrations. Xylophone ensembles have also
featured strongly as pupils have rediscovered the en-
joyment that can be shared by all as we make music
together.
Mr Shane Porter
Prep School Music Teacher
